Nolimit City Review

Nolimit City is a leading online casino game provider. Players who appreciate variety and striking, sometimes bizarre, themes are particularly fond of this provider. Nolimit City was founded in 2014, and the first game was released a year later. Since then, the game selection has grown significantly.

What Makes Nolimit City Special?

Nolimit City distinguishes itself from other game providers at non-GamStop casinos in several ways. Its key features are bold themes, high variance, and innovative mechanics.

Bold Themes

Nolimit City doesn’t shy away from unusual or provocative topics. While many developers choose safe and mainstream concepts, Nolimit City experiments with controversial and dark themes. Think of games like Mental, Remember Gulag, or Karen Maneater—titles and themes rarely, if ever, found at other developers in non-GamStop casinos.

High Variance Slots

Most Nolimit City games are extremely volatile at non-GamStop casinos. This means the slots offer relatively small but potentially very large payouts. Some slots have a maximum win of up to 100,000 times the bet. This appeals particularly to high-risk players seeking substantial payouts.

Keep in mind that high volatility isn’t for everyone. You may go dozens of spins without a win. These slots have a low hit rate, so you need a sufficient balance to play long enough to trigger larger wins. Consider carefully before betting your entire budget.

Innovative Features: xMechanic

Nolimit City has developed many unique game features at non-GamStop casinos. The provider now has so many trademark features that even we can hardly keep up. Below are some of the most popular and innovative mechanics in the xMechanic series—each beginning with the letter “x,” making them easy to recognise.

xMount

The xMount feature was introduced in 2022, debuting in the slot Little Bighorn. xMount activates extra features via special symbols or triggers, giving you more potential winning opportunities. These features may include multipliers, symbol transformations, or expansions. The increased potential for larger wins adds excitement.

xCrash

xCrash is an optional feature added in 2024. It appears in the Nolimit City slot Skate or Die, among others. When triggered, a progressive multiplier increases until it “crashes.” You must cash out before the crash to secure your winnings. Waiting too long results in losing everything. This effectively turns part of the slot into a crash-style game.

xZone

Added in 2023, xZone boosts wins by applying +1 multipliers to adjacent symbols. This can result in very large payouts. Nolimit City even describes xZone as “the secret sauce to some mouthwatering wins.” This feature also appears in the slot Gluttony.

xNudge

The xNudge feature works with Wild symbols. Slots with this mechanic include Stacked Wilds, which don’t always land fully on the reels. An xNudge pushes a Stacked Wild to fill the entire reel. If a Wild doesn’t fully cover the reel, it’s nudged up or down. Each nudge increases the multiplier by +1. This mechanic is particularly effective in slots like Tombstone and The Crypt.

xWays

The xWays feature brings dynamic gameplay. Slots with xWays contain a special Mystery Symbol that transforms into another symbol when it appears. Additional temporary symbols may also land, increasing the number of Ways to Win. This significantly increases winning potential.

This system is often compared by gambling experts to Megaways due to the huge number of possible combinations. For example, the slot Punk Rocker has between 243 and 46,656 Ways to Win thanks to xWays. This feature is also found in Dragon Tribe and San Quentin xWays.

xBomb

xBomb slots have a unique playing field, partly locked at the start. Locked areas can be opened through explosions. When an xBomb Wild lands, it triggers an explosion that removes all adjacent symbols—except Scatters. New symbols then cascade into place, potentially forming new winning combinations. If another win occurs, an extra row is unlocked.

The maximum number of rows is seven. Expanding the playing field dramatically increases Ways to Win. For example, Fire in the Hole offers between 64 and 46,656 Ways to Win. Each explosion also increases the multiplier by +1, starting at x1. This feature also appears in Misery Mining and Dead Canary.

xSplit

Landing an xSplit symbol causes certain symbols to split into two or four. Sometimes xSplit divides itself, sometimes splits symbols to the left, and sometimes splits all premium symbols. The exact behaviour depends on the slot. Splitting increases the Ways to Win, and after the split, xSplit symbols turn into Wilds—boosting your winning chances even further.

This mechanic often results in more Ways to Win than even most Megaways slots. For example, xWays Hoarder xSplit starts with 243 Ways to Win but can reach 259,920 thanks to xSplit. The feature also appears in Benji Killed in Vegas and Rock Bottom.

xPays

xPays is used less frequently but offers unique gameplay. With xPays, adjacent symbols on the first three reels trigger a type of respin. Normally, winning symbols disappear during a respin—but with xPays, it’s the non-winning symbols that are removed. New symbols drop in, potentially forming new wins. The number of collected winning symbols multiplied by their value determines the final payout. This feature appears in Monkey’s Gold.

xCluster

In slots with the xCluster feature, you win by forming clusters—groups of identical symbols. To trigger xCluster, you must first activate Free Spins. Landing at least two clusters in one spin activates the mechanic. You then receive a progressive multiplier that increases by +1 for each winning cluster within the same spin, after which it resets.

In some bonus rounds, the multiplier does not reset between spins, allowing it to grow endlessly throughout the Free Spins feature. xCluster debuted in the slot The Border.
